Transaction 31b597ed36fcffe54c87b073b14029a29bbda13756aecadb4e86d3e30a2593a2

1 Input
2 Outputs
  • 31b597ed36fcffe54c87b073b14029a29bbda13756aecadb4e86d3e30a2593a2:0
  • value  1308350
    address  3At5vUjv5d1qJNwZq76BJfvkv1xVnSGzAW
  • 31b597ed36fcffe54c87b073b14029a29bbda13756aecadb4e86d3e30a2593a2:1
  • value  71050794
    address  1CKeybe9UgF3wtdow159jSA9Bc5JkXpTwD